Output 3c21c002535ba3f8454cc31408f04590f43670f2b6809948c708fcafe259bb22:2

value
26559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 753160aaa4696fa7dfe4a5fd6e4422e764e301ba OP_EQUAL
address
3CNg8oaozryMjsU9NStRYQo53uvUaV1uZP
transaction
3c21c002535ba3f8454cc31408f04590f43670f2b6809948c708fcafe259bb22
spent
true